Replacing deck footings is a crucial part of maintaining the safety and longevity of your deck, especially in Upper Marlboro, MD, where weather conditions can take a toll on outdoor structures. Understanding the cost of deck footing replacement can help homeowners budget effectively and ensure they are getting the best value for their investment.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Material Type: The type of materials used, such as concrete or metal, can significantly influence the overall cost.
  • Deck Size: Larger decks require more footings, which increases both material and labor costs.
  •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Upper Marlboro, MD can vary, impacting the final price.
  •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may require additional preparation or specialized footings, raising costs.
  • Permits and Inspections: Obtaining necessary permits and passing inspections can add to the overall expense.
  • Accessibility: Difficult-to-access areas may require special equipment or more labor, increasing costs.
  •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ect the timeline and cost, especially if additional measures are needed to protect the work area.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Upper Marlboro, MD)
Basic Footing Installation $150 - $300 per footing
Concrete Footings $200 - $400 per footing
Metal Footings $250 - $450 per footing
Soil Testing and Preparation $100 - $200
Permit Fees $50 - $150
Inspection Fees $75 - $125

Understanding these factors and costs can help you plan your deck footing replacement project more effectively, ensuring a safe and durable deck for years to come.
